Operative and post-operative outcomes
| Characteristics | Robot (n=13) | Open (n=13) | ||
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Mean operation time (min) | ||||
| Total | 360.5 (223–520) | 183.8 (115–250) | 0.001 | |
| Console time | 262.1 (143–450) | 0.006 | ||
| Combined operation | ||||
| Total | 4 (30.8) | 1 (7.7) | 0.135 | |
| Endometriosis spot electrocoagulation | 3 | 1 | ||
| Paratubal cystectomy | 1 | 0 | ||
| EBL (mL) | 219.2 (70–700) | 323.1 (100–1,000) | 0.724 | |
| Δ Hemoglobin (g/dL)a) | 2.4 (0.5–4.4) | 2.7 (0.3–4.7) | 0.528 | |
| No. of transfusion needed | 2 (15.4) | 6 (46.1) | 0.089 | |
| Postoperative abdominal drain | 4 (30.8) | 4 (30.8) | >0.999 | |
| Length of stay (day)b) | 2.5 (2–4) | 3.5 (3–5) | 0.003 | |
Results are presented as mean (minimum–maximum) or number (%).
EBL, estimated blood loss.
a)Cases of transfusion during operation excluded; b)Postoperative hospital stay.
Fig. 1The relations between the operative time and the characteristics of the removed myomas. (A) The number of resected myomas, (B) the maximum diameter of the myomas, (C) the sum of the diameters, and (D) the mass of resected myomas were not significantly correlated with the operative time.
